What is CPR?

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ation (MOUTH-TO-MOUTH RESUSCITATION) is an emergency treatment created to recover blood circulation and breathing in individuals who have actually experienced heart attack or various other respiratory system failings. It integrates upper body compressions with artificial air flow to preserve blood flow to the brain and other essential organs.

Why is CPR Important?

The importance of mouth-to-mouth resuscitation can not be overemphasized. According to the American Heart Association, effective prompt CPR can double or triple a victim's opportunity of survival after cardiac arrest. As a matter of fact, every minute that passes without CPR decreases the survival price by around 10%.

The Basics of CPR Techniques

How to Execute CPR

When somebody falls down suddenly, you may question exactly how to do CPR efficiently. Here's a detailed overview:

Assess the Situation: Inspect if the person is responsive and breathing. Call for Help: Dial emergency situation services immediately. Begin Breast Compressions:
    Place your hands on the center of the chest. Use your body weight to press at least 2 inches deep at a rate of 100-120 compressions per minute.
Provide Rescue Breaths (if educated):
    After every 30 compressions, offer two rescue breaths-- make certain that the upper body increases visibly.

Incorrect Compression Depth

One usual blunder in performing mouth-to-mouth resuscitation is not achieving the proper compression deepness. Pressing as well shallowly can reduce blood circulation to essential organs dramatically. Constantly go for at the very least 2 inches deep in adults.

Infant and Kid CPR Techniques

Infant mouth-to-mouth resuscitation Technique

Performing mouth-to-mouth resuscitation on infants calls for different methods due to their size and frailty:

Positioning: Lay the baby on their back on a company surface. Chest Compressions: Use 2 fingers positioned just below the nipple area line; press concerning 1.5 inches deep at a rate of 100-120 per minute. Rescue Breaths: Cover the baby's mouth and nose with your mouth and offer mild smokes up until you see their breast rise.

Using an AED with CPR Australia

Understanding exactly how an AED works alongside CPR can dramatically boost survival possibilities:

Turn on the AED asap after calling emergency services. Follow aesthetic triggers offered by the device while continuing with upper body compressions up until it suggests you otherwise.
